The earliest known published reference to the word ambigram was by Hofstadter, who attributed the origin of the expressed word to conversations among a little group of friends during 1983-1984. Robert Petrick, who designed the invertible Angel brand in 1976, was also an early on impact on ambigrams. John Langdon produced the first reflection image logo design "Starship" in 1975. Langdon and Kim are most likely the two artists who've been most responsible for the popularization of ambigrams. John Langdon and Scott Kim each thought that that they had created ambigrams in the 1970s also. The mirror ambigram DeLorean Motor Company logo was first used in 1975. In 1969, Raymond Loewy designed the rotational NEW MAN ambigram logo design, which continues to be used today. Lavin, whose "chump" was publicized in June, published, "I think it is in the only word in the British language which has this peculiarity," while Clarence Williams published, about his "Guess" ambigram, "Possibly B is the sole letter of the alphabet that will produce such an interesting anomaly." Of particular interest is the actual fact that all four of the folks submitting ambigrams thought them to be always a uncommon property of particular words.

The Verbeek strip "The UpsideDowns of old man Muffaroo and little woman Lovekins" used ambigrams in 3 consecutive strips in March,1904, but in any other case the format of this strip avoided the utilization of term balloons.įrom to September June, 1908, the English regular The Strand publicized some ambigrams by different people in its "Curiosities" column.

In Topsys & Turvys Number 2 2 (1902), Newell ended with a variant on the ambigram in which THE END changes into PUZZLE 2. The past page in his book Topsys & Turvys contains the phrase THE final end, which, when inverted, reads PUZZLE. Although better known for his children's catalogs and illustrations for Mark Twain and Lewis Carroll, he posted two literature of invertible illustrations, in which the picture turns into a different image totally when turned upside down. The earliest known non-natural ambigram schedules to 1893 by designer Peter Newell. Hofstadter describes an ambigram as a "calligraphic design that handles to press two different readings into the selfsame set of curves." Different ambigram designers (sometimes called ambigramists) may create completely different ambigrams from the same phrase or words, differing in both form and style. The meaning of the ambigram might either change, or stay the same, when interpreted or viewed from different perspectives.ĭouglas R.
